GadgetWide Cloud Control is an older, third-party software utility primarily known for its claims to bypass the iCloud Activation Lock on iOS devices. While it was once popular among enthusiasts looking for "free" ways to unlock second-hand iPhones and iPads, its modern reputation is marred by security concerns and a high failure rate on updated hardware. The Evolution of GadgetWide Cloud Control GadgetWide gained traction during the iOS 7 and iOS 8 eras when Apple first introduced the Activation Lock as a theft deterrent. The tool functioned as a "bypass server," tricking the device into communicating with a third-party server rather than Apple's official activation servers. This was intended to allow users to reach the home screen of a locked device without the original owner's Apple ID. Functional Limitations and Risks Despite its historical popularity, the tool has several critical drawbacks: Outdated Compatibility : The software was designed for older chips and iOS versions; modern security patches and newer processors (A12 and later) have rendered most of these bypass methods ineffective. Questionable Legitimacy : Many reviewers and tech security forums, such as Software Informer , categorize the tool as "fake" or "scammy" because it often fails to complete the promised unlock on contemporary devices. Security Hazards : Because the software is unsigned and often distributed through unofficial mirrors, users frequently report it being flagged by antivirus programs for potential trojans or malware. Account Requirements : Users were typically required to register on the GadgetWide website before use, raising concerns about data privacy and the harvesting of personal information. The Modern Alternative: Legitimate Unlocking If you are facing an iCloud lock, security experts on platforms like Reddit's setupapp community generally advise against using "magic" software like GadgetWide. Instead, they recommend: Contacting the Original Owner : This is the only official way to remove the lock permanently. Proof of Purchase : Apple can sometimes remove Activation Lock if you can provide the original receipt at an Apple Support center. Verified Jailbreak Tools : For older devices (iPhone X and older), tools based on hardware exploits (like Checkm8) are considered more reliable than legacy bypass software.
